需要安装react-app-rewired@2.0.2-next.0 需要babel-plugin-import 扩展react里面的webpack配置,新建config-overrides.js const {injectBabelPlugin} = require('react-app-rewi ...
分类:
Web程序 时间:
2019-01-25 23:23:13
阅读次数:
490
项目组织结构 ajax数据请求的封装和api接口的模块化管理 第三方库按需加载 利用less的深度选择器优雅覆盖当前页面UI库组件的样式 webpack实时打包进度 vue组件中选项的顺序 路由的懒加载 路由模块拆分化管理 项目组织结构 清晰的项目结构能让别人开发进来更容易理解,当然,每个人都有一定 ...
分类:
其他好文 时间:
2019-01-23 23:27:04
阅读次数:
334
第1章 课程简介本章内容会给大家通览本门课程的所有知识点。第2章 Yii2框架的Assets前端资源发布的使用本章我们会详细学习Assets组件的使用,使用Nav插件和Breadcrumbs插件进行导航的加载,轻松安装加载第三方组件JSTree完成无限分类的树形展示,如何设置前端资源文件按需加载和使 ...
分类:
其他好文 时间:
2019-01-23 00:21:03
阅读次数:
223
一、懒加载 也叫延迟加载或者按需加载,即在需要的时候进行加载, 二、为什么要使用懒加载 像vue这种单页面应用,如果没有应用懒加载,运用webpack打包后的文件将会异常的大,造成进入首页时,需要加载的内容过多,时间过长,会出啊先长时间的白屏,即使做了loading也是不利于用户体验,而运用懒加载则 ...
分类:
其他好文 时间:
2019-01-21 21:01:45
阅读次数:
176
我们常把公共的header以及footer提炼出来,但是每个子页面的css和js又不相同,如果都写在了父模板里,对不需要的子模板来说是负担,造成不必要的开销,此时就需要按需加载,laravel给我们提供了这样的便利 父模板里 在需要加载 js/css 的位置写入 子模板 css 同理 提示: 相应的 ...
分类:
Web程序 时间:
2019-01-19 17:28:25
阅读次数:
330
1.全局安装yarn 2.创建react项目,并用yarn start 运行 3.引入antd 4.在app.js引入button 5.修改 src/App.css,在文件顶部引入 antd/dist/antd.css 6.按需加载模块 7.修改package.json,绿色替换红色 8. 根目录创 ...
分类:
其他好文 时间:
2019-01-16 13:11:35
阅读次数:
1375
【描述】 按照antd官网步骤 https://ant.design/docs/react/use-with-create-react-app-cn 最后yarn start会报错 【解决方法】 原因是react-scripts 升级到 2.1.2 以后破坏了 react-app-rewired 解 ...
分类:
移动开发 时间:
2019-01-12 15:26:31
阅读次数:
352
在vue单页应用中,当项目不断完善丰富时,即使使用webpack打包,文件依然是非常大的,影响页面的加载。如果我们能把不同路由对应的组件分割成不同的代码块,当路由被访问时才加载对应的组件(也就是按需加载),这样就更加高效了。——引自vue router官方文档 如何实现?? vue异步组件 vue ...
分类:
Web程序 时间:
2019-01-05 16:31:01
阅读次数:
181
实现图片按需加载的方法,当要显示内容的高度超过了页面的高度,按需加载,根据滚动条的位置来判断页面显示的内容 这个类似于京东或淘宝页面,根绝页面的滚动,显示下面的内容 如下图所示,一开始并不是所有的图片都显示,当滚动条移动到页面最下面的时候,再显示下面的内容 解决思路:通过判断滚动条是否滚动到了页面的 ...
分类:
Web程序 时间:
2019-01-03 19:23:54
阅读次数:
213